2026 Compare Cities Commuting:
Middletown, CT vs Philadelphia, PA

Change Cities
Highlights
- The average commute for residents of Philadelphia is 11.3% longer than it is for residents of Middletown.
- 13.6% more residents of Philadelphia work from home compared to residents of Middletown.
